What is very important in education is how students have etiquette (moral ethics) in applying the knowledge they have gained, so that students deserve the title of Ulul Albab, meaning that the purpose of education is none other than to improve the morals or morals of students so that they have morality. KH. Hasyim 'Asya'ri stated that if the success of students is closely related to their adab (moral ethics) when studying, then the success of an educator will undoubtedly depend on his moral ethics when teaching. Because the problem of education cannot be separated from the term Ulul Albab, the duties and competencies of educators' moral ethics, the problem that the author will seek answers to is how the correlation between Ulul Albab and educators is, what are the duties of educators and what competencies must be possessed by an educator. This study uses a science of interpretation approach with accentuative theory and uses thematic method (al-mawdu'iyyah). The results of this study are the correlation between Ulul Albab and educators is very close, the duties of an educator other than murabby and mu'allim, as well as references, mentors and instructor, moral mentor and mudarris.The competence of an educator is intelligent, deep knowledge (al-Raisikhun fi al-'ilm), broad religious knowledge, while moral ethics must have akhlaq karimah
